Deck ramp installation services involve the construction and secure fitting of ramps that provide easy access to decks, porches, or elevated outdoor spaces. This process typically includes assessing the property’s layout, designing a ramp that fits the space and meets accessibility needs, and then building a sturdy, durable structure using materials suitable for outdoor use. Skilled contractors ensure that the ramp is properly anchored, level, and compliant with safety standards, making the transition between ground level and elevated areas smooth and secure.

These services help solve common accessibility challenges faced by homeowners, especially those with mobility issues, injuries, or aging family members. A properly installed deck ramp can eliminate steps or uneven surfaces that may pose tripping hazards or prevent wheelchair access. Additionally, ramps can be useful during renovations or repairs when traditional stairs are temporarily unusable. By providing a safe, reliable pathway, deck ramp installation enhances both safety and convenience around the home.

The overview below groups typical Deck Ramp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or deck ramp repairs or adjustments usually fall in the $250-$600 range. Many routine jobs on existing structures are completed within this band, depending on the scope of work.

Standard Installation - Installing a new deck ramp or replacing a damaged section gener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Many proj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this range, while more complex setups may cost more.

Full Replacement - Complete deck ramp replacements for larger areas tend to range from $3,500 to $7,000. Larger, more intricate projects can exceed this range, but most fall within the typical band for comprehensive installations.

Custom or Complex Projects - Custom designs or challenging site conditions can push costs above $7,000, with some specialized projects reaching $10,000 or more. These are less common and usually involve additional features or unique requ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a deck ramp? Installation typically includes assessing the site, designing the ramp to meet accessibility needs, preparing the foundation, and securely attaching the ramp to the existing deck and ground.

Are there different types of deck ramps available? Yes, local contractors can install various types such as wood, composite, or metal ramps, tailored to the specific requirements and preferences of the property owner.

What factors influence the complexity of a deck ramp installation? Factors include the slope of the terrain, the height of the deck, local building codes, and the desired materials for the ramp.

Can a deck ramp be customized for specific needs? Many service providers offer custom options to accommodate unique site conditions, accessibility requirements, or aesthetic preferences.

How do local contractors ensure the safety of a deck ramp? They follow proper installation practices, ensure stability and support, and use quality materials to create a safe, durable ramp.
